A Children’s Dentist Explains the Benefits of Dental Sealants

A Children’s Dentist Explains the Benefits of Dental Sealants from Grand Parkway Pediatric Dental in Richmond, TXDental sealants are one of the preventive treatments our children’s dentist recommends to protect your kids against tooth decay, the leading dental issue that affects children. Dental sealants are protective blockades placed on teeth to seal out bacteria and foods that cause decay.

According to the American Academy of Pediatric Dentistry, sealants decrease the risk of cavities by 86% after a year and 58% after four years. Applying dental sealants on teeth is an effective way to protect against decay, but many parents do not know much about them since the procedure was developed in the last two decades.

Our children’s dentist explains the benefits of dental sealants

Tooth decay is caused by bacteria that are part of the mouth’s ecosystem consuming sugars in tiny food particles left on teeth and converting them into teeth-destroying acids. These microbes coat teeth with plaque – the sticky film that accumulates on teeth – and produce acids that eat away teeth structures. Plaque can be removed by brushing and flossing.

Plaque left on teeth for more than 24 hours hardens into tartar. Tartar is too hard for a toothbrush or floss to remove, so it keeps bacteria protected as they damage teeth. A scaler is used to remove tartar during teeth cleaning procedures performed by dentists.

According to our children’s dentist, dental sealants form a barrier that prevents food, bacteria, and acids from making contact with the biting surfaces of teeth, preventing them from pit and fissure decay. The number of teeth each child needs sealants on varies based on how vulnerable they are to decay. The American Dental Association recommends protecting all primary biting teeth (molars) with sealants as soon as they erupt. All of a child’s teeth are vulnerable to decay, but the molars are the most susceptible due to their positions in the back of the mouth and flat design. Parents should consider getting all of their children’s teeth coated with sealants for maximum protection.

The benefits of covering teeth with sealants include:

1. Fewer cavities for up to four years

Dental sealants reduce the risk of decay by 58% up to four years after the treatment. Sealants can also be topped up as needed to ensure continuous protection. Fewer cavities mean your child spends less time dealing with agonizing toothaches that can distract them from focusing on important things like schoolwork. It also means fewer emergency trips to the dentist.

2. Fewer tooth decay treatments

Protecting a child’s teeth with dental sealants means less need for restorative dental treatments that treat tooth decay. While some tooth decay treatments like the application of fillings are quite affordable, others like the placement of crowns and root canals are not. A child needing fewer tooth decay treatments leads to lower dental bills for parents.

3. Keep your child’s smile healthy

Tooth decay can ruin a child’s smile in different ways. It can cause baby teeth to fall out prematurely, leading to bite issues in the future. Tooth decay also discolors teeth, ruining how your child’s teeth look. Coating a child’s teeth with dental sealants protects them from the top dental issue children face and keeps their smiles healthy.
